TRAILER BRAKE OPERATION
The trailer brake is controlled by the electric brake. The electric brake receives stop lamp switch signal at elec-
tric brake (pre-wiring) terminal 2 when the brake pedal is depressed.
When the brake pedal is depressed, power is supplied by the electric brake
through electric brake (pre-wiring) terminal 3
to trailer connector terminal 3.
TRAILER POWER SUPPLY OPERATION
The trailer power supply is controlled by the trailer tow relay 2.
When the ignition switch is in the ON or START position, power is supplied
through 10A fuse (No. 51, located in the IPDM E/R)
through IPDM E/R terminal 16
to trailer tow relay 2 terminal 1.
When energized, the trailer tow relay 2 supplies power
through trailer tow relay 2 terminals 5 and 7
to trailer connector terminal 5.

System DescriptionEKS00BB6
When room lamp and personal lamp switch is in DOOR position, room lamp and personal lamp ON/OFF is
controlled by timer according to signals from switches including key switch and key lock solenoid, front door
switch LH, unlock signal from keyfob, door lock and unlock switch, front door lock assembly LH (key cylinder
switch), ignition switch, and glass hatch ajar switch.
When room lamp and personal lamp turns ON, there is a gradual brightening over 1 second. When room lamp
and personal lamp turns OFF, there is a gradual dimming over 1 second.
The room lamp and personal lamp timer is controlled by the BCM (body control module).
Room lamp and personal lamp timer control settings can be changed with CONSULT-II.
Ignition keyhole illumination turns ON when front door LH is opened (door switch ON) or key is removed from
key cylinder. Illumination turns OFF when front door LH is closed (door switch OFF).
Step and foot lamps turn ON when front or rear doors are opened (door switch ON). Lamps turn OFF when
front and rear doors are closed (all door switches OFF).

ROOM LAMP TIMER OPERATION
When lamp switch is in DOOR position and all conditions below are met, BCM performs timer control (maxi-
mum 30 seconds) for interior room lamp and map lamp ON/OFF.
Power is supplied

through 10A fuse [No. 19, located in the fuse block (J/B)]
to key switch and key lock solenoid terminal 3.
Key is removed from ignition key cylinder (key switch OFF), power will not be supplied to BCM terminal 37.
Serial data is supplied
to BCM terminal 22
through main power window and door lock/unlock switch terminal 14.
At the time that front door LH is opened, BCM detects that front door LH is unlocked. It determines that interior
room lamp and map lamp timer operation conditions are met, and turns the interior room lamps ON for 30 sec-
onds.
Key is in ignition key cylinder (key switch ON), power is supplied
through key switch and key lock solenoid terminal 4
to BCM terminal 37.
When key is removed from key switch and key lock solenoid (key switch OFF), power supply to BCM terminal
37 is terminated. BCM detects that key has been removed, determines that interior room lamp and map lamp
timer conditions are met, and turns the interior room lamps ON for 30 seconds.
When front door LH opens → closes, and the key is not inserted in the key switch and key lock solenoid (key
switch OFF), BCM terminal 47 changes between 0V (door open) → 12V (door closed). The BCM determines
that conditions for interior room lamp operation are met and turns the interior room lamp ON for 30 seconds.
Timer control is canceled under the following conditions.
Front door LH is locked [when locked by keyfob, main power window and door lock/unlock switch, or front
door lock assembly LH (key cylinder switch)]
Front door LH is opened (front door switch LH turns ON)
Ignition switch ON.
INTERIOR LAMP BATTERY SAVER CONTROL
If interior lamp is left “ON”, it will not be turned off even when door is closed.
BCM turns off interior lamp automatically to save battery 30 minutes after ignition switch is turned off.
BCM controls interior lamps listed below:
Va n i t y l a m p
Room/map lamp
Cargo lamp
Personal lamp
St ep la m ps
Puddle lamps
Foot lamps
Ignition keyhole illumination
After lamps turn OFF by the battery saver system, the lamps illuminate again when
signal received from keyfob, or main power window and door lock/unlock switch or front door lock assem-
bly LH (key cylinder switch) is locked or unlocked
door is opened or closed
key is removed from ignition key cylinder (key switch OFF) or inserted in ignition key cylinder (key switch
ON).
Interior lamp battery saver control period can be changed by the function setting of CONSULT-II.

How to Proceed With Trouble DiagnosisEKS00BBA
1. Confirm the symptom or customer complaint.
2. Understand operation description and function description. Refer to LT- 1 3 5 , "
System Description" .
3. Carry out the Preliminary Check. Refer to LT- 1 4 8 , "
Preliminary Check" .
4. Check symptom and repair or replace the cause of malfunction.
5. Does the interior room lamp operate normally? If YES: GO TO 6. If NO: GO TO 4.
6. Inspection End.
